Section 2: The Executive Council

Article LO6322-10

The powers of the Executive Council expire at the opening of the first meeting of the Territorial Council following its full renewal.

CHAPTER I: Powers of the Territorial Council

Article LO6351-8

The empowerment granted by the law or by the decree to the territorial council expires at the end of a period of two years from its publication.
